THE POSITION
The Talent Manager role will focus on improving the quality and variety of guests from the entertainment industry, with guests from movies, television, comics, anime/manga, pop culture art and toys, and more.
The Talent Manager will serve as the main point of contact for recruiting and contracting celebrity and other entertainment guests for all MCM Comic Con events. These guests will primarily be attached to our autograph area, but could also be guests for the comic programming as well. The person in this position will be key in driving collaboration with our content team on panels and content relating to these events around contracted talent. This includes responsibility for every aspect of this area, managing the event team, creating and adhering to budgets, communicating regularly with the content and operations teams, and successfully staging the event to the delight of our fans.
Working collaboratively with the ReedPOP Global Talent Manager, the MCM Talent Manager will help recommend and sometimes secure talent for the portfolio of ReedPOP global shows.
